There is no gainsaying the fact that of all the countries, particularly among our neighbours, China is the only country which can be trusted upon as it has always stood by us in our difficult times. It is an open secret that in 1965 Indo-Pak war the then Chinese premier Chou-en-Lai had, as a goodwill gesture, placed at our disposal, the use of the Chinese air force planes in case of need. PIA was the only carrier among the world airlines which used to be given preferential treatment by the Chinese and when the Americans wanted to mend fences with Beijing they used Pakistan as a go-between in their parleys with the Chinese leadership.
Beijing’s open support to Pakistan on the Kashmir dispute has been a matter of extreme satisfaction for us. The massive investment of Beijing in the economic corridor speaks volumes for the sound economic ties between us and the Chinese. All this is fair enough but we should not put all eggs in one basket. We should go the whole hog in improving our ties with Moscow also, another big neighbor of ours, with whom our relationship is not as good as it should have been. It is a pity that successive governments in this country have ignored Moscow in their quest to appease Washington with the result that Russia still looks upon our leadership with distrust and suspicion. Development of bilateral ties with other countries is extremely essential because in international relations ground realities do change with the passage of time and the possibility that our friendly countries might change their loyalties tomorrow cannot be ruled out altogether.
